Denise Marie Stazel-Monaghan
September 24th, 1958 - November 14th, 2015
Denise Marie Stazel-Monaghan, age 57, passed away peacefully at home on Saturday, November 14, 2015, in Mountlake Terrace, WA after a hard fought battle with cancer. She was born to John and Yvonne Stazel on September 24, 1958 in Spokane, WA. She was raised in a large family with five siblings. The family relocated to Whidbey Island, and then to Kent, WA. Denise attended Kent-Meridian High school, where she was a talented clarinet player in the school band.After high school, Denise made her living as an entrepreneur in the food services business. She owned and operated several businesses over her lifetime, including a gelato store, coffee stand, and catering business. Denise was a gifted artist and craftsperson, always making something- beautiful mosaic s, a towering river rock fireplace, beach-themed mirrors, and various sewing projects. A wonde cook and baker, she hosted many gatherings of friends and family in her home. She had an exemplary green thumb, spending hours tending a gorgeous garden she honed over 20 years. She was known for her boisterous laugh and had a witty and sometimes raunchy sense of humor. She passed her weekends at her very own beach home on Whidbey Island, a dream she realized this past summer. Although she possessed many gifts and had many hobbies, her greatest passions in life were her friends and family. Denise tended her relationships with loving care, and could make conversation with just about anybody, making friends wherever she went. She loved to have fun and was usually the life of the party. She was an incredibly dedicated mother, tirelessly advocating for her son with autism, and spoiling her children rotten. She was thrilled to bestow this love on her first grandchild born this summer. Denise is survived by son Sean, daughter Kendall and son-in-law Ryan; beloved granddaughter Piper; her parents; sister Lisa; brothers Andrew, Timothy, Kurtis, and Brian; ex-husband Joseph; many nieces, nephews, and cousins; a lovely collection of dear friends; and her best buddy Lucy the French Bulldog. All are welcome to attend a Celebration of Denises Life at Palisade Restaurant in Seattle on December 6 from 2 to 5pm. The family would like to thank the staff at Swedish Cancer Institute. Donations to honor Denises memory may be made to the Trust of Sean Monaghan c/o Joe Monaghan or the Arc of Snohomish County.
